About the school: Don Bosco High School and Junior College, Lonavala (Pune), is a well-known educational institution run by the Salesians of Don Bosco (SDB), a Roman Catholic religious institute founded by St. John Bosco. This school is part of a global network of Don Bosco institutions known for their focus on academic excellence, character formation, and youth development.

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?

For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.
